AXESS Energy™ develops behind-the-meter generation, storage, and grid-integration infrastructure to power the next generation of AI compute and autonomous mobility campuses — where utility timelines can't keep pace with tenant load.
Platform
Our platform integrates on-site generation, storage, and grid coordination into a single power delivery model — bridging utility interconnect ramps with dispatchable, campus-owned capacity.
On-site fuel-cell and photovoltaic generation sized to complement utility supply and reduce campus load on the local grid.
Utility-scale battery energy storage for peak shaving, load smoothing, and campus-level resilience during grid events.
Grid interconnection, protection coordination, and dispatch logic engineered around the load profile of the campus tenant.
